TEXAS BOUND: Tropical Storm Don is bound for the Texas coast. The above map reflects the possible paths of the eye of the storm. Note: the map does not reflect the possible vastness of the storm, only the center of the storm.
Tropical Storm Don, the fourth storm of the 2011 hurricane season, is expected to make landfall on the Texas coast sometime Friday night or Saturday morning.
Don's maximum sustained wind as of Wednesday evening was approximately 40 mph and was moving WNW at 12 mph. In order to be upgraded to hurricane status, a tropical storm must reach maximum sustained winds of 74 mph. Tropical depression status requires winds less than 39 mph.
Weather experts hope Don will bring some much needed rainfall to a severely drought-ridden Texas.
